Abstract


This paper deals with the production of Late llispanic Sigillata in the South of the Península and propases to denominate it as TSHTM. This kínd of pottery has a clear relationship with the Hispanic and North-african Terra Sigillata and the author s tudíes its geographic diffusion. Sorne part of this pottery was known until now as «sigillatas paleocristianas de Cástulo» and had been connected with the Late Gallic productions
